#include "config.h"
#include "PlatformImage.h"
#if USE(SKIA)
#include "NativeImageSkia.h"
#include "PlatformContextSkia.h"
#elif USE(CG)
#include <CoreGraphics/CGBitmapContext.h>
#include <CoreGraphics/CGContext.h>
#include <CoreGraphics/CGImage.h>
#include <wtf/RetainPtr.h>
#else
#error "Need to implement for your platform"
#endif
namespace WebCore {
PlatformImage::PlatformImage()
{
}
void PlatformImage::updateFromImage(NativeImagePtr nativeImage)
{
#if USE(SKIA)
// The layer contains an Image.
NativeImageSkia* skiaImage = static_cast<NativeImageSkia*>(nativeImage);
const SkBitmap* skiaBitmap = skiaImage;
IntSize bitmapSize(skiaBitmap->width(), skiaBitmap->height());
ASSERT(skiaBitmap);
#elif USE(CG)
// NativeImagePtr is a CGImageRef on Mac OS X.
int width = CGImageGetWidth(nativeImage);
int height = CGImageGetHeight(nativeImage);
IntSize bitmapSize(width, height);
#endif
size_t bufferSize = bitmapSize.width() * bitmapSize.height() * 4;
if (m_size != bitmapSize) {
m_pixelData = adoptArrayPtr(new uint8_t[bufferSize]);
memset(m_pixelData.get(), 0, bufferSize);
m_size = bitmapSize;
}
#if USE(SKIA)
SkAutoLockPixels lock(*skiaBitmap);
// FIXME: do we need to support more image configurations?
ASSERT(skiaBitmap->config()== SkBitmap::kARGB_8888_Config);
skiaBitmap->copyPixelsTo(m_pixelData.get(), bufferSize);
#elif USE(CG)
// FIXME: we should get rid of this temporary copy where possible.
int tempRowBytes = width * 4;
// Note we do not zero this vector since we are going to
// completely overwrite its contents with the image below.
// Try to reuse the color space from the image to preserve its colors.
// Some images use a color space (such as indexed) unsupported by the bitmap context.
RetainPtr<CGColorSpaceRef> colorSpaceReleaser;
CGColorSpaceRef colorSpace = CGImageGetColorSpace(nativeImage);
CGColorSpaceModel colorSpaceModel = CGColorSpaceGetModel(colorSpace);
switch (colorSpaceModel) {
case kCGColorSpaceModelMonochrome:
case kCGColorSpaceModelRGB:
case kCGColorSpaceModelCMYK:
case kCGColorSpaceModelLab:
case kCGColorSpaceModelDeviceN:
break;
default:
colorSpaceReleaser.adoptCF(CGColorSpaceCreateDeviceRGB());
colorSpace = colorSpaceReleaser.get();
break;
}
RetainPtr<CGContextRef> tempContext(AdoptCF, CGBitmapContextCreate(m_pixelData.get(),
width, height, 8, tempRowBytes,
colorSpace,
kCGImageAlphaPremultipliedFirst | kCGBitmapByteOrder32Host));
CGContextSetBlendMode(tempContext.get(), kCGBlendModeCopy);
CGContextDrawImage(tempContext.get(),
CGRectMake(0, 0, static_cast<CGFloat>(width), static_cast<CGFloat>(height)),
nativeImage);
#else
#error "Need to implement for your platform."
#endif
}
} // namespace WebCore
